Inspector’s narrative

What the inspector wrote

S1 & S2 admitted/ confirmed that the main heater for the classroom did break in November and that a repair company was called November 17, repairs were quoted November 18th and repairs started early December but were halted because they are waiting for parts due to supply chain issues. Upon arrival on 1/10/22 at 10:05am, LPA observed that the indoor temperature reading on the wall thermostat was 66 degrees which is below the 68 degree minimum regulation temperature in a room where children are present. S2 also stated that the classroom was cold in the mornings when the children arrived due to the heat being off overnight before the space heaters were upgraded the beginning of January when space heaters would be left on overnight. Based on interviews, observations and document review, the preponderance of evidence standard has been met; therefore, the above allegations are found to be SUBSTANTIATED. The following violation of the California Code of Regulations, Title 22; Division 6, was observed: see LIC 9099-D. This report was reviewed and discussed with S1. Appeal Rights were provided, and exit interview was conducted. All licensing reports are public information and must be made available upon request for at least three years. S1 was provided with a Notice of Site Visit (NOS) to be posted in the facility for 30 days.

What does Type A vs Type B mean?

Type A. Serious citation. Imminent or substantial risk to children. The regulator requires corrective action immediately and may impose a civil penalty.

Type B. Lower-severity citation. Corrective action required, no imminent risk. The regulator monitors compliance on the next visit.
